Rilska Skakavitsa waterfall — Attraction in Sapareva Bania

Name
Rilska Skakavitsa waterfall
Description
The Skakavitsa Waterfall is the highest waterfall in the Rila Mountains in Bulgaria. It is part of Rila National Park and is located on the Skakavitsa River. The waterfall is situated on approximately 2,000 m above sea level, the water falling down from 70 m.

Once you pass the Tourist Info Center it's about 3km till you see a fork on the road with a lot of signs (pic below) bare right, it's anothr 1km on a pretty broken pot holed road, but doable. Once you see a hotel and parking area park. Google maps will tell you to keep going for another 2km, don't! that road is only for 4x4 with really big puddells and rough driving conditions. I'll devide it to 3 sections from easy to hard. 1st part of the hike is great, flat, easy gravel path. 2nd part, once you take a right turn towards the forest is still pretty flat with some mild inclines very peaceful, beautiful, cooler and shaded with so much to explore around the path. 3rd part is the hardest one with steep inclines. It took us an hour and a half to get to Skakavitsa Hut (Hizha Skakavitsa) but we really enjoyed our time exploring the unbelievable amount of different mushrooms! From the Hut, it's another 30 minutes to the waterfalls mainly uphill. The path is beautiful and worth the hike by itself. Waterfalls are gorgeous and pretty massive, especially after all the rain. I recommend getting there early so you have time to explore. Warm cloth are highly recommended as the path is mostly shaded and cool. There are toilets at the hut and trash...

Най-красивият водопад и най-високият в Рила който задължително трябва да посетите! Но, моля прибирайте си салфетките след като ги ползвате ,аз толкова салфетки не бях виждал дори и в гръцки ресторант.😮 🤦 Маршрута е почти изцяло в гората на сянка ,преминахме го в един от горещите дни на август и си беше достатъчно прохладно и приятно. След хижа Скакавица до водопада има не повече от 20 минути шарена сянка. Дори и под водопада може да намерите сянка ,а и често има някой друг облак. Цялото разстояние е 5км в посока като време го дават 1:30 минути ,но ако сте с деца ,почивате често и се любувате на природата може да си умножите времето х2. Не бих казал , че има сериозно изкачване , просто който няма добра физическа активност да си почива по-често. Имаше много деца и възрастни хора който не видях да изглеждат изморени. Когато чуете по-сериозно шума от реката в ляво на пътеката до дървена оградка и път зад нея ,отбийте се на първата невероятна гледка на водопад малка Скакавица който не видях да е отбелязан с табела. В хижа Скакавица предлагат супа ,кафе ,чай ,вафли и др. Вода си носете защото няма работещи чешми по пътя. По пътя за "Седемте рилски езера" малко след Паничище има табела и път в дясно за "Зелени преслап" и почивна база "Хидрострой" с голям паркинг до който се стига по малко разбит път ,но се минава спокойно и с лека кола. Стягайте раниците , вземете си торбички за салфетки и право...

Водопад Рилска Скакавица и пътеката към него са много красиви. Трябва да се отиде и да се види на живо. От началото на пътеката при хижа "Зелени преслап" до водопад Рилска Скакавица може да се стигне за около 2 часа и 15 минути среднобързо ходене, задължително с включено подробно бързо снимане през 20-30 метра. За опитните планинари пътеката е лека и сравнително не най-дълга, но високопланинските пътеки и обекти излиза, че не са от същото измерение като обикновените - и като мащаб, и като качество. В началото пътеката тръгва по горски път. След 20 минути се отклонява надясно към хижа Скакавица и навлиза в хубава гора. Половин час след това започва част от пътеката с по-стръмно изкачване към хижата. Отляво се чува реката. Препоръчва се отбиване до нея на места, особено ако е пълноводна, защото има хубави междинни водопади. След изкачването се продължава наляво и се достига до хижа Скакавица - хубаво място за почивка. От нея продължава много красива пътека до водопада, с разнообразна растителност (част от Ботанически маршрут "Скакавица"). През август имаше много цъфнали лилави и жълти растения. Водопадът е много висок и изключително красив. Отдясно има високи сенчести скали, на които може да се види...

Amazing place. Very scenic. About 13 km total back and forth. The making of the red route is not always great and you lose some very nice sights with the stream, if you follow it 100% (some nice smaller waterfalls there). The last 500 m. for the parking is quite bad and almost unpassable if your car is low. You can walk to the parking, as there are a few parking spots below the 500 m drive..
